• Bot Management Market: Key Players, Opportunities, and Forecast

    In today’s digital landscape, automated attacks carried out by malicious bots have emerged as a critical concern for businesses worldwide. These “bad bots” are increasingly sophisticated, capable of mimicking human behavior to bypass traditional security measures. They can execute a wide range of harmful activities, from credential stuffing and account takeovers to data theft, application fraud, ad fraud, API abuse, and card fraud. The consequences of such attacks are severe, including financial losses, compromised customer trust, and potential regulatory penalties.

    To counter these evolving threats, organizations are turning to bot management solutions. These tools leverage advanced bot intelligence, behavioral analytics, and machine learning algorithms to detect and mitigate malicious traffic in real time. By analyzing patterns such as interaction speed, navigation paths, and device characteristics, bot management systems can distinguish between genuine users and automated threats. This enables businesses to safeguard their websites, mobile applications, and APIs without disrupting the experience for legitimate visitors.

    A core objective of bot management solutions is to maintain a seamless user experience. Unlike traditional security measures, which may block or challenge users indiscriminately, modern bot management tools are designed to be precise. They perform continuous, automated assessments of incoming traffic to evaluate intent, ensuring that legitimate customers can access services without friction while bad bots are blocked or challenged effectively. This balance is critical in protecting revenue streams and maintaining user trust.

    However, organizations must recognize that the threat landscape is constantly changing. Bad bots are continuously evolving, adopting new strategies to evade detection and mimic human interactions more convincingly. As a result, the capabilities of bot management solutions can vary significantly depending on the vendor, technology, and approach employed. Some tools may excel in protecting APIs, while others focus on preventing account takeover or ad fraud. Businesses must carefully evaluate their security needs and choose solutions that align with their specific risk profiles and digital environments.

  • How to Increase Webinar Sign-Ups Using Multi-Channel Marketing
    In today’s crowded digital landscape, promoting a webinar with just one channel is no longer enough. B2B audiences are spread across platforms—email inboxes, social media feeds, search engines, and professional networks. To stand out and drive meaningful registrations, marketers must adopt a multi-channel approach that delivers consistent messaging across multiple touchpoints.
    Multi-channel marketing is not about being everywhere—it’s about being strategic, coordinated, and relevant. When executed effectively, it can significantly increase webinar sign-ups, improve audience quality, and maximize return on investment.
    Let’s explore how to leverage multi-channel marketing to boost your webinar registrations.
    1. Start with a Strong Foundation: Landing Page Optimization
    Before driving traffic from multiple channels, ensure your webinar landing page is optimized for conversions. All your marketing efforts will lead here, so it must clearly communicate value and make registration easy.
    Key elements of a high-converting webinar landing page include:
    • A compelling headline that highlights the benefit
    • Clear agenda and key takeaways
    • Speaker credentials to build credibility
    • A simple, mobile-friendly registration form
    • Strong call-to-action (CTA)
    Keep the messaging concise and focused on what the audience will gain, not just what you will present.
    2. Email Marketing: Your Primary Conversion Channel
    Email remains one of the most effective channels for webinar promotion, especially in B2B marketing. However, sending a single invite is rarely enough.
    Create a structured email campaign that includes:
    • Initial announcement email
    • Follow-up emails highlighting different value points
    • Reminder emails closer to the event date
    • Last-chance registration emails
    Segment your email lists based on audience interests, job roles, or past engagement. Personalized emails tend to perform significantly better than generic blasts.
    Also, experiment with subject lines, send times, and messaging to optimize open and click-through rates.
    3. Social Media Promotion for Broader Reach
    Social media platforms are powerful for expanding your reach beyond your existing audience. Platforms like LinkedIn, Twitter, and even niche communities can drive significant webinar traffic when used strategically.
    Best practices include:
    • Posting regularly leading up to the webinar
    • Using engaging visuals and short video teasers
    • Highlighting key speakers and discussion points
    • Encouraging employees and partners to share posts
    On LinkedIn, consider using a mix of organic posts and paid promotions to target specific industries, job roles, and companies.
    Consistency is key—don’t rely on a single post. Build momentum over time.
    4. Paid Advertising to Scale Registrations
    If you want to accelerate sign-ups, paid media is essential. Platforms like LinkedIn Ads, Google Ads, and display networks allow you to target high-intent audiences.
    Effective paid strategies include:
    • Retargeting website visitors who didn’t register
    • Targeting lookalike audiences similar to your existing leads
    • Promoting high-performing content pieces related to your webinar topic
    Ensure your ad creatives align with your landing page messaging for a seamless user experience. Even small inconsistencies can reduce conversion rates.
    5. Content Marketing to Build Interest
    Content marketing plays a crucial role in warming up your audience before promoting the webinar. Instead of pushing direct registrations immediately, create valuable content that builds interest around your topic.
    Examples include:
    • Blog posts related to the webinar theme
    • Short LinkedIn articles or posts
    • Infographics or quick insights
    • Pre-webinar videos or speaker snippets
    You can then integrate webinar CTAs within this content, making the promotion feel natural rather than forced.
    6. Leverage Partnerships and Co-Marketing
    Partnering with industry influencers, vendors, or complementary brands can significantly expand your reach. Co-hosted webinars often perform better because they tap into multiple audiences.
    Ways to leverage partnerships:
    • Ask partners to promote the webinar to their email lists
    • Co-create content and social posts
    • Feature guest speakers with strong personal brands
    This not only increases registrations but also enhances credibility and trust.
    7. Use Retargeting to Capture Missed Opportunities
    Not everyone who visits your landing page will register on the first visit. Retargeting helps you bring those users back.
    Use retargeting ads to:
    • Remind visitors about the webinar
    • Highlight urgency as the event date approaches
    • Showcase testimonials or key benefits
    This strategy ensures you don’t lose high-intent prospects who need an extra push to convert.
    8. Align Messaging Across All Channels
    One of the biggest mistakes in multi-channel marketing is inconsistent messaging. Your email, social posts, ads, and landing page should all communicate the same core value proposition.
    Consistency builds trust and reinforces your message. It also ensures that no matter where a prospect interacts with your campaign, they receive a cohesive experience.
    Create a unified campaign theme, including:
    • Consistent visuals
    • Clear messaging pillars
    • A single, strong CTA
    9. Create Urgency and FOMO (Fear of Missing Out)
    Urgency is a powerful driver of conversions. As the webinar date approaches, shift your messaging to emphasize limited availability or time sensitivity.
    Examples:
    • “Seats are filling fast”
    • “Last chance to register”
    • “Don’t miss out on exclusive insights”
    Countdown timers, reminder emails, and last-day promotions can significantly boost registrations.
    10. Measure, Optimize, and Improve
    Multi-channel marketing is not a one-time effort—it’s an ongoing process of testing and optimization.
    Track key metrics such as:
    • Registration rates by channel
    • Cost per registration
    • Email open and click rates
    • Landing page conversion rates
    Use these insights to refine your strategy for future webinars. Over time, you’ll identify which channels and tactics deliver the best results.
    Conclusion
    Increasing webinar sign-ups requires more than just sending invitations—it demands a coordinated, multi-channel strategy that engages your audience at every stage of their journey.
    By combining email marketing, social media, paid advertising, content marketing, partnerships, and retargeting, you can create a powerful promotional engine that drives consistent and high-quality registrations.
    The key is integration. When all channels work together with aligned messaging and clear goals, your webinar promotion becomes more effective, scalable, and impactful.

  • Smart Event Marketing: Turning B2B Events into Revenue Engines
    Event marketing remains one of the most powerful ways for B2B companies to connect with prospects, build relationships, and generate high-quality leads. Whether it’s trade shows, conferences, or virtual events, the opportunity to engage directly with decision-makers is invaluable.
    But here’s the challenge events are expensive. Without a clear strategy, they can quickly turn into a cost center instead of a revenue driver. To truly maximize ROI, B2B marketers need a smart, structured, and data-driven approach.
    Why Event Marketing Still Matters in B2B
    In a digital-first world, face-to-face (or live virtual) interactions stand out. Events provide:
    • Direct access to decision-makers
    • Opportunities for meaningful conversations
    • Stronger brand recall and trust
    • High-intent lead generation
    However, success depends on how well you plan, execute, and follow up.
    Smart Strategies to Maximize Event ROI
    1. Set Clear Goals and KPIs
    Before participating in any event, define what success looks like. Is it lead generation, brand awareness, meetings booked, or pipeline creation?
    Clear KPIs help you measure performance and justify investment.
    2. Target the Right Audience
    Not all events are worth attending. Focus on events where your ideal customer profile (ICP) is most likely to be present.
    Quality of audience matters more than quantity.
    3. Start Engagement Before the Event
    Successful event marketing begins long before the event itself. Use email campaigns, LinkedIn outreach, and targeted ads to:
    • Build awareness
    • Schedule meetings in advance
    • Warm up prospects
    This ensures you don’t rely only on walk-in traffic.
    4. Deliver Personalized Experiences
    At the event, avoid generic pitches. Tailor your conversations, demos, and messaging based on each prospect’s needs.
    Interactive experiences like live demos or one-on-one consultations can significantly increase engagement.
    5. Capture and Qualify Leads Effectively
    Collecting leads is not enough you need to qualify them. Use digital tools to capture data and categorize leads based on:
    • Interest level
    • Role and decision-making power
    • Buying intent
    This helps prioritize follow-ups.
    6. Follow Up Quickly and Strategically
    The biggest mistake in event marketing is poor follow-up. Reach out within 24–48 hours with personalized messages, relevant content, or meeting requests.
    Timely follow-up keeps your brand fresh in the prospect’s mind.
    7. Measure and Optimize Performance
    After the event, analyze results:
    • Number of qualified leads
    • Meetings booked
    • Pipeline generated
    • Revenue influenced
    Use these insights to improve future event strategies.
    Common Mistakes to Avoid
    • Attending events without clear goals
    • Targeting the wrong audience
    • Relying only on booth traffic
    • Delayed or generic follow-ups
    • Not measuring ROI
    Avoiding these mistakes can significantly improve outcomes.
    Conclusion
    Event marketing can be a powerful revenue driver but only when executed strategically. By focusing on the right audience, engaging prospects before and after the event, and measuring performance effectively, B2B companies can turn events into high-impact growth opportunities.
    In today’s competitive landscape, it’s not about attending more events it’s about making every event count.
